Role Overview:

This role involves optimising and streamlining our InVision analysis pipeline while also working with the assay development team to build novel methods and contribute to the design and creation of new products. This position offers the exciting opportunity to work at the frontier of cancer diagnostics while seeing the entire product development pipeline from concept, clinical validation, to commercial product. This role will involve the analysis of NGS cancer genomics data, biomarker development, innovative algorithm design and optimisation of Inivata's technology. We expect that applicants will have prior experience in the field of bioinformatics and a good understanding of NGS analysis, for example a MSc or PhD degree in a relevant field and/or industry experience.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Contribute to the development of novel methodologies and algorithms for the analysis of ctDNA.
  • Analyse, summarize and interpret NGS data sets using existing and customized approaches.
  • Contribute to technology development by providing insights into computational solutions and identifying suitable workflows.
  • Interpret the outcome of proof of concept experiments and help to improve the design jointly with the tech-dev team.
  • Develop production ready, regulatory compliant code in partnership with the software development team,
  • Support the rollout, optimisation and improve scalability of Inivata 's analysis pipelines
  • Provide support to clinical, business development and other departments for novel and existing products

Requirements

Education/Qualifications:

  • PhD in the field of computational biology/bioinformatics/applied statistics, or significant experience in that space.

Requirements:

  • Experience with next generation sequence data analysis (Essential).
  • Experience in novel algorithm development, data mining and machine learning (Essential).
  • Scientific programming experience, using either R or Python (Essential).
  • Experience with variant calling, exome/WGS pipelines or other high-throughput genomics workflows (Desired).
  • Experience with cancer genomics or related data sets (e.g. epigenetics) (Desired).
  • Prior experience with work in a regulated environment, in particular for software and quality assurance, such as ISO 13485, EN 62304, ISO 15189, or other (Desired).
  • Excellent communication and presentation skills.
